[Ord. 8-2010, 11 § 1, passed 4-26-2010]
A certain document, three copies of which are on file in the office of the City Clerk of the City of Lebanon, being marked and designated as the International Fuel Gas Code, 2009 Edition, including Appendix Chapters A through D as published by the International Code Council, be and is hereby adopted as the Fuel Gas Code of the City of Lebanon in the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ania for regulating and governing fuel gas systems and gas-fired appliances as herein provided; providing for the issuance of permits and collection of fees therefore; and each and all of the regulations, provisions, penalties, conditions and terms of said Fuel Gas Code on file in the Office of the City Clerk are hereby referred to, adopted and made a part hereof, as if fully set out in this article, with the additions, insertions, deletions and changes, if any, prescribed in section 1707.02 of this article.
[Ord. 8-2010, 11 § 2, passed 4-26-2010]
The following sections of the International Fuel Gas Code, 2009 Edition, as adopted are hereby deleted, altered or amended as follows:
IFGC 101.1 Title.
These regulations shall be known as the "Fuel Gas Code of the City of Lebanon," hereinafter referred to as "this code."
IFGC 106.6.2 Fee Schedule. delete in entirety
IFGC 106.6.3 Fee Refunds. delete in entirety
IFGC 108.4 Violation Penalties.
Any person who fails to correct a violation or institute a remedial action as ordered by the enforcing official or who violates a provision or fails to comply with any requirements of this article or code or any of the other applicable codes or ordinances shall be guilty of a summary offense, for each violation, punishable by a fine of not less than $50 or more than $1,000 plus costs of prosecution and/or be imprisoned not more than 90 days. Each day that a violation continues shall be deemed a separate offense.
IFGC 108.5 Stop Work Orders. (insert) $50 and $1,000
